Turn your idea into a startup
Take this course
Quickly and easily discover how to start an internet business. Remove the lengthy paperwork, the bank visits, legal complexity, and numerous fees, launch your startup from anywhere in the world.

Access the US financial system from anywhere!
Your new company and bank account will be ready within days. Incorporate your company and do business with customers around the globe.
Grow and scale with free credits
Every dollar matters when you start your company. Get more than $100,000 in credits from our partners, including Amazon Web Services and Google Cloud.
Get going in about 20 minutes
We guide you through the essentials and handle the rest. Fill out a bit of information, which takes about 20 minutes, and then we?ll begin creating the legal framework for your?company. Discover how to
- Form a US based (Delaware) C Corp or LLC legal entity
- Get a US Bank account and debit card
- The world’s best online payment system and payment processor